SSR-GLINJECT(1) SimpleScreenRecorder Manual SSR-GLINJECT(1) NAME ssr-glinject - Run a command while injecting the SimpleScreenRecorder GLInject library. SYNOPSIS ssr-glinject [OPTIONS] [--] COMMAND DESCRIPTION This script uses LD_PRELOAD to inject the GLInject library into the given command, so that SimpleScreenRecorder can record it. It should be safe to use this on all applications (including command-line programs and shell scripts). If the program doesn't use OpenGL, it should have no effect. If you find a program that crashes or behaves incorrectly when GLInject is used, please submit a bug report. OPTIONS --help Show help message. --glx-debug Enables GLX debugging. This may reduce the performance and print lots of error messages, but it is useful to track down bugs. --relax-permissions Uses mode 666 instead of 600 for shared memory, so that other users can record the stream. This is insecure and should not be used on a computer that can be accessed by other users that you don't trust. --channel=CHANNEL Channel name to use. The default is 'channel-USERNAME'.
